Output e6173de6d63b68e372c285c0a2a86292bfc071662d93dfbee904eba63962439b:0

value
13359366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 341c6a283f6ad880a94863c5a7e5a5e86b00ea71 OP_EQUALVERIFY OP_CHECKSIG
address
15kYBGAmp3Qyo51YCx2W6bsEpjHYYudifG
transaction
e6173de6d63b68e372c285c0a2a86292bfc071662d93dfbee904eba63962439b
confirmations
316539
spent
true